Common FrontPanel.exe Errors on Windows

Encountering errors associated with FrontPanel.exe can be frustrating. These errors may vary in nature and can surface due to different reasons, such as software conflicts, outdated drivers, or even malware infections. Below, we've outlined the most commonly reported errors linked to FrontPanel.exe, to aid in understanding and potentially resolving the issues at hand.

  • Unable to Start Correctly (0xc000007b): This alert appears when the application cannot initiate correctly, often resulting from a mismatch between the Windows version and the application regarding 32-bit and 64-bit configurations.
  • FrontPanel.exe - Bad Image Error:: This error arises when Windows cannot run FrontPanel.exe due to the file being corrupted, or because the associated DLL file is missing or corrupted.
  • Not a Valid Win32 Application: This error message signifies that the program is incompatible with the Windows version in use, or the program file could be damaged.
  • Error 0xc0000005: This alert emerges when there is an issue related to access violation, often the result of memory faults, presence of malware, or drivers that are no longer up-to-date.
  • FrontPanel.exe File Not Executing: This warning appears when the executable file fails to launch as expected. Reasons could include damaged file data, improper file permissions, or insufficient system resources.
